This month honors the contributions, achievements, and legacy of African Americans. However, Black Americans’ contributions to the field of mental health have been long overlooked. During the month of February, CMHCM will highlight some of the trailblazers!
Bebe Moore Campbell was an American author, journalist, teacher, and mental health advocate who worked tirelessly to shed light on the mental health needs of the Black community and other underrepresented communities. She founded NAMI-Inglewood in a predominantly Black neighborhood to create a space that was safe for Black people to talk about mental health concerns.
